Replacement Timbren Axle System For a Tandem Axle 7 X 14 Enclosed Trailer
Question:
I have a all aluminum 7X14 enclosed double torsion axel trailer. I hit a pothole, it destroyed the rim and tire. It bent the Torsion axel as well. Will your product work on this application? Is the price per product or for a pair. Do I need to change both axels with yours or will 1 work for now. Maybe I will need to change both? Thank you for your time.
asked by: Kenny S
Expert Reply:
It appears the Timbren Axle-Less Trailer Suspension System w Electric Brake Hubs # A35RD545E would be the kit you need on your 7'X14' enclosed trailer. To verify this is the correct option for your trailer you will need to verify a couple measurements on your trailer. First this is a replacement for a 3,500lb axle that will give you a hub face that sits 6" off of the trailer frame. The axle centerline will sit 1/4" below the base of the frame rail and the suspension will compress 1-3/4" vertically. You will want to ensure this is similar to your current axle so that your wheels and tires fit without allowing them to touch the fenders or frame.
If you find any of your measurements are different please let me know what measurements you have and I can verify if this will fit.
I recommend changing both axles so that you will not have 2 different suspension systems. With the different suspensions you could experience issues as one axle may carry more weight as they will likely compress and rebound at different rates.
